Active@ KillDisk — Active@ KillDisk is a secure data erasure software that provides disk sanitization and data destruction for HDDs and SSDs. It can permanently erase confidential information from hard drives.

Context-Shredder — Context-Shredder is an open-source web browser extension that aims to increase user privacy. It automatically deletes browsing history, cookies, and cache after each browsing session.

Key Features Comparison

Active@ KillDisk
Active@ KillDisk Features
  • Secure data erasure for HDDs and SSDs
  • Permanent data destruction
  • Supports various erasure standards (DoD 5220.22-M, NIST 800-88, etc.)
  • Bootable USB/CD/DVD for erasing non-bootable drives
  • Detailed logging and reporting
  • Supports multiple languages
Context-Shredder
Context-Shredder Features
  • Automatic deletion of browsing history, cookies, and cache after each session
  • Open-source web browser extension
  • Increased user privacy

Pros & Cons Analysis

Active@ KillDisk
Active@ KillDisk
Pros
  • Comprehensive data erasure capabilities
  • Compliance with various data destruction standards
  • Bootable environment for erasing non-bootable drives
  • Detailed reporting and logging for audit purposes
Cons
  • Can be complex for non-technical users
  • No free version available, only trial
  • May be overkill for casual users
Context-Shredder
Context-Shredder
Pros
  • Enhances user privacy by removing sensitive data
  • Easy to use, no user intervention required
  • Open-source and free to use
Cons
  • May cause some inconvenience if users need to access previously stored data
  • Limited to web browser usage, does not cover other applications
